Tips for Identifying Unlicensed Brokers

To avoid falling prey to unlicensed brokers, it is essential to be aware of the warning signs. Some key indicators include:

  • Missing or fake license information
  • Unrealistic promises of high returns
  • Lack of transparency in operations and fee structures
  • Unprofessional or unresponsive customer support
  • Poor online reviews and ratings

By being vigilant and doing thorough research, individuals can reduce their risk of encountering unlicensed brokers and investment scams.

Steps to Take After Falling for a Scam

If you have fallen victim to a scam, it is crucial to take immediate action to minimize your losses. Here are some steps to follow:

  1. Stop all communication: Cease all interactions with the scammer, including phone calls, emails, and messages.
  2. Report the scam: Inform relevant authorities, such as the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) or your local consumer protection agency, about the scam.
  3. Contact your bank or payment provider: Notify your bank or payment provider about the scam and ask them to freeze your accounts or reverse any suspicious transactions.
  4. Consider identity theft protection: If you have shared personal or financial information with the scammer, consider investing in identity theft protection services to safeguard your identity.
  5. Warn others: Share your experience through reviews and scam reporting websites to help others avoid falling victim to the same scam.
